Transaction 503ca946e0bfec906b4795de1e58344dde1c88a5bad3620f34640144125f4847

1 Input
1 Outputs
  • 503ca946e0bfec906b4795de1e58344dde1c88a5bad3620f34640144125f4847:0
  • value  1144087810
    address  384Dzk1PD8uJrLehJDUj2L2iiUaGoAD21N